$12.5 million "isn't enough" for roads

Almost 30 per cent of Baw Baw Shire's capital works budget will be directed to roadworks in the next financial year.
Council has allocated $12.5 million to road projects, matching its commitment in last year's budget.
However, according to Cr Danny Goss, that figure isn't nearly enough.
"I don't see enough money in roads," Cr Goss said. "I'd like to see at least another $1 million going into our roads contract, our upgrades there, to assist with road maintenance and drainage."
The road projects proposed in the 2024/25 capital works program include $9.3 million of renewal works and $3.2 million of new capital works.
